Transaction 5718848bcf215193bb958603282196b33d04a2335106afb2767a359f03de846b

1 Input
2 Outputs
  • 5718848bcf215193bb958603282196b33d04a2335106afb2767a359f03de846b:0
  • value  755553
    address  39YPmZX2ASEvwk2nyuLLaeFm8GifkHCVaf
  • 5718848bcf215193bb958603282196b33d04a2335106afb2767a359f03de846b:1
  • value  142453
    address  bc1qaa893adw0tqdhln69mhszfztd9x4e7h7rhkp4d